Los marcos de Arquitectura Empresarial (EA) proporcionan la estructura necesaria para alinear la estrategia empresarial con las capacidades de TI. El Marco de Arquitectura del Grupo Abierto (TOGAF) sigue siendo una de las normas más ampliamente adoptadas en este dominio. Esta guía ofrece un recorrido detallado del Método de Desarrollo de Arquitectura (ADM), centrándose en el camino desde la fase preliminar hasta la planificación de la migración. Al comprender cada etapa, las organizaciones pueden asegurarse de que sus decisiones arquitectónicas apoyen los objetivos a largo plazo, manteniendo al mismo tiempo la flexibilidad.

Comprendiendo el ciclo ADM de TOGAF 🔄
El núcleo de TOGAF es el Método de Desarrollo de Arquitectura (ADM). Es un proceso iterativo diseñado para guiar la creación e implementación de la arquitectura empresarial. El ADM no es una lista lineal de verificación, sino un ciclo que se repite a medida que evolucionan las necesidades del negocio. A continuación se presenta un resumen de las fases involucradas en este ciclo de vida.
| Fase | Área de enfoque | Resultado clave |
|---|---|---|
| Preliminar | Preparación del escenario | Definición del marco de arquitectura |
| Fase A | Visión de arquitectura | Documento de visión de arquitectura |
| Fase B | Arquitectura empresarial | Modelo de arquitectura empresarial |
| Fase C | Arquitecturas de sistemas de información | Modelos de datos y aplicaciones |
| Fase D | Arquitectura de tecnología | Modelo de infraestructura de tecnología |
| Fase E | Oportunidades y soluciones | Plan de migración de implementación |
| Fase F | Planificación de la migración | Plan de implementación de la migración |
| Fase G | Gobernanza de implementación | Entregables de gobernanza |
| Fase H | Gestión del cambio de arquitectura | Solicitud de cambio de arquitectura |
La gestión de requisitos es un componente central que se conecta con todas las fases. Asegura que la arquitectura permanezca alineada con las necesidades de los interesados durante todo el proceso de desarrollo.
Fase 0: La fase preliminar 🎯
Antes de construir cualquier arquitectura específica, la organización debe preparar su entorno. La fase preliminar establece la base. Es aquí donde la empresa define los principios, estándares y restricciones que guiarán el trabajo de arquitectura.
Actividades clave en la fase preliminar
- Definir la capacidad de arquitectura: Determinar cómo funcionará la arquitectura dentro de la organización. Esto incluye roles, responsabilidades y los conjuntos de habilidades necesarios.
- Establecer el principio de arquitectura: Crear directrices de alto nivel que rigen la toma de decisiones. Estos principios aseguran la consistencia en todos los proyectos futuros.
- Seleccionar herramientas y estándares: Elegir los lenguajes de modelado y las herramientas de repositorio que se utilizarán para documentar la arquitectura.
- Definir el alcance: Identificar los límites del esfuerzo de arquitectura. ¿Se trata de una visión integral de la empresa o de una unidad de negocio específica?
La salida de esta fase es un marco TOGAF adaptado. No es una copia pegada del estándar; se adapta para ajustarse a la cultura y el tamaño específicos de la organización.
Fase A: Visión de arquitectura 👁️
La Fase A establece el contexto para todo el proyecto. El objetivo es definir el alcance e identificar a los interesados que influirán o serán influenciados por la arquitectura.
Objetivos principales
- Identificar interesados: Listar a todas las personas que tienen interés en el resultado. Esto incluye líderes empresariales, personal de TI y usuarios finales.
- Definir el caso de negocio: Explicar por qué es necesario el esfuerzo de arquitectura. ¿Qué problemas está resolviendo?
- Establecer el alcance: Delimitar claramente lo que está dentro del alcance y lo que está fuera del alcance para esta iteración.
- Establecer la visión de arquitectura: Crear una visión de alto nivel del estado futuro que los interesados puedan comprender.
Durante esta fase se produce el documento de visión de arquitectura. Este documento sirve como contrato entre el equipo de arquitectura y el negocio. Describe los objetivos, las restricciones y los beneficios esperados. Si la visión no se acuerda aquí, el proyecto corre el riesgo de perder apoyo más adelante.
Fase B: Arquitectura empresarial 🏢
Una vez establecida la visión, la atención se centra en el negocio en sí. La Fase B describe los procesos del negocio, la gobernanza, la organización y las entidades clave del negocio.
Entregables principales
- Modelo de procesos del negocio: Un mapa de cómo fluye el trabajo a través de la organización. Esto destaca ineficiencias y oportunidades de mejora.
- Mapa organizacional: Una representación de las unidades del negocio y sus relaciones.
- Catálogo de servicios del negocio: Una lista de los servicios que el negocio proporciona a clientes internos o externos.
- Modelo de funciones del negocio: Un desglose de las capacidades necesarias para operar el negocio.
El arquitecto de negocio trabaja estrechamente con los líderes del negocio para asegurar que el modelo refleje la realidad. Esta fase es crítica porque garantiza que la solución de TI realmente apoye las operaciones del negocio. Si la arquitectura del negocio es débil, es probable que las arquitecturas de datos y tecnología subsecuentes fallen al entregar valor.
Fase C: Arquitecturas de sistemas de información 🗄️
La Fase C a menudo se divide en dos subfases: Arquitectura de datos y Arquitectura de aplicaciones. Traduce los requisitos del negocio en necesidades de información y software.
Arquitectura de datos
- Definir entidades de datos: Identificar los objetos de datos clave (por ejemplo, Cliente, Producto, Pedido) que la organización gestiona.
- Establecer el flujo de datos: Mapa de cómo los datos se mueven entre sistemas y procesos.
- Establecer estándares de datos: Definir convenciones de nomenclatura, formatos y niveles de seguridad para los activos de datos.
Arquitectura de aplicaciones
- Mapa de aplicaciones: Identificar los sistemas de software utilizados para apoyar los procesos del negocio.
- Analizar interacciones: Comprender cómo las aplicaciones se comunican entre sí (APIs, integraciones, intercambio de datos).
- Identificar brechas: Determinar si las aplicaciones actuales apoyan el modelo de negocio futuro o si se necesitan nuevas soluciones.
Esta fase cierra la brecha entre las necesidades del negocio y la implementación técnica. Garantiza que los datos sean consistentes y que las aplicaciones no estén aisladas innecesariamente.
Fase D: Arquitectura de tecnología 💻
La Fase D se enfoca en la infraestructura necesaria para apoyar las aplicaciones y datos definidos en la Fase C. Esto incluye hardware, redes y servicios en la nube.
Consideraciones clave
- Especificaciones de hardware:Defina la potencia de procesamiento, los requisitos de almacenamiento y memoria.
- Topología de red:Planifique la conectividad entre sitios, usuarios y centros de datos.
- Infraestructura de seguridad:Establezca firewalls, métodos de cifrado y controles de acceso.
- Estrategia en la nube:Decida qué componentes residirán en instalaciones propias y cuáles se alojarán en la nube.
La arquitectura de tecnología debe ser lo suficientemente robusta para manejar la carga esperada de las operaciones empresariales. También debe ser escalable para acomodar el crecimiento futuro. La seguridad es una preocupación primordial en esta etapa, ya que la infraestructura protege los datos y aplicaciones definidos en fases anteriores.
Fase E: Oportunidades y soluciones 🧩
Después de definir la arquitectura objetivo, la Fase E identifica la brecha entre el estado actual y el estado futuro. Luego determina el mejor camino para cerrar esa brecha.
Decisiones estratégicas
- Análisis de brechas:Compare la arquitectura base con la arquitectura objetivo para encontrar piezas faltantes.
- Identifique proyectos:Enumere las iniciativas específicas necesarias para pasar del estado actual al objetivo.
- Construya el caso de negocio:Justifique la inversión para cada proyecto identificado.
- Agrupe proyectos:Organice los proyectos en flujos de trabajo o carteras lógicas.
Esta fase es donde la arquitectura pasa de la teoría a la acción. Define los bloques de construcción que se implementarán. La salida es una estrategia de implementación de alto nivel que guía la planificación en la siguiente fase.
Fase F: Planificación de la migración 📅
La planificación de la migración es el puente entre el diseño y la ejecución. Crea un cronograma detallado y un plan para implementar la arquitectura.
Componentes de planificación
- Secuenciación de proyectos:Determine el orden en que deben ejecutarse los proyectos. Algunos proyectos deben completarse antes de que otros puedan comenzar.
- Asignación de recursos:Asigne presupuesto y personal a flujos de trabajo específicos.
- Evaluación de riesgos: Identifique obstáculos potenciales y cree estrategias de mitigación.
- Plan de implementación: Cree una hoja de ruta detallada con hitos y fechas límite.
Un plan de migración bien estructurado evita el caos durante la implementación. Asegura que los interesados sepan qué esperar y cuándo esperarlo. El plan también debe tener en cuenta posibles retrasos o cambios en las prioridades empresariales.
Fase G: Gobernanza de la implementación 🛡️
Una vez que los proyectos comienzan, la Fase G asegura que se mantengan fieles a la arquitectura. Actúa como un mecanismo de control de calidad durante la ejecución del plan.
Actividades de gobernanza
- Verificaciones de cumplimiento: Verifique que las soluciones implementadas coincidan con los estándares arquitectónicos.
- Revisión de cumplimiento arquitectónico: Realice revisiones formales en los hitos clave.
- Gestión de conformidad: Aborde las desviaciones del plan y apruebe los cambios necesarios.
Sin gobernanza, los proyectos pueden desviarse de la arquitectura prevista, lo que conduce a deuda técnica e problemas de integración. El comité de gobernanza asegura que la inversión entregue el valor prometido.
Fase H: Gestión del cambio arquitectónico 🔄
El cambio es constante. La Fase H asegura que la arquitectura evolucione conforme cambia el entorno empresarial. Gestiona las solicitudes de cambios en la arquitectura.
Proceso de gestión del cambio
- Monitoree el entorno: Mantenga la vigilancia sobre factores externos como regulaciones, cambios de mercado y nuevas tecnologías.
- Revise la arquitectura: Evalúe periódicamente si la arquitectura actual aún cumple con las necesidades del negocio.
- Gestione las solicitudes: Evalúe las solicitudes de cambio para determinar si se alinean con la estrategia.
- Actualice la documentación: Asegúrese de que el repositorio de arquitectura refleje el estado actual.
Esta fase cierra el ciclo, alimentando conocimientos de vuelta a la Fase Preliminar o reiniciando el ciclo ADM para nuevas iteraciones. Asegura que la arquitectura permanezca relevante con el tiempo.
Gestión de requisitos: el bucle central 🔄
La gestión de requisitos no es una fase; es un proceso continuo que atraviesa cada paso del ADM. Asegura que la arquitectura permanezca alineada con los requisitos del negocio.
Funciones clave
- Recopilación: Recopile los requisitos de los interesados en toda la organización.
- Análisis:Evalúe los requisitos en cuanto a viabilidad y alineación.
- Rastreabilidad:Vincule los requisitos con los artefactos de arquitectura para asegurarse de que se aborden.
- Monitoreo:Monitoree el estado de los requisitos durante todo el ciclo de vida del proyecto.
Al mantener un proceso sólido de gestión de requisitos, las organizaciones pueden evitar construir soluciones que no satisfagan las necesidades de los usuarios. Actúa como el ancla que mantiene la arquitectura arraigada en la realidad.
Mejores prácticas para el éxito 🏆
Implementar TOGAF con éxito requiere disciplina y compromiso. Las siguientes prácticas pueden ayudar a las organizaciones a navegar eficazmente el ADM.
- Involucre a los interesados desde temprano:No espere hasta la fase de Visión para involucrar a los líderes empresariales. Su aporte es crucial desde el inicio.
- Itere con frecuencia:El ADM es iterativo. No intente perfeccionar cada fase antes de pasar a la siguiente. Permita la refinación durante el proceso.
- Mantenga la documentación:Mantenga el repositorio de arquitectura actualizado. La documentación desactualizada genera confusión y errores.
- Enfóquese en el valor:Pregunte siempre cómo la arquitectura aporta valor al negocio. Si no lo hace, reconsidere el enfoque.
- Capacite al equipo:Asegúrese de que todos los arquitectos comprendan el marco y la adaptación específica de la organización.
Consideraciones finales para los equipos de arquitectura ⚙️
Construir arquitectura empresarial es una tarea compleja. Requiere equilibrar las limitaciones técnicas con las ambiciones empresariales. El marco TOGAF proporciona una ruta estructurada, pero depende del equipo ejecutarla con precisión.
El éxito depende de una comunicación clara, una planificación rigurosa y una gobernanza continua. Al seguir los pasos descritos en esta guía, las organizaciones pueden construir arquitecturas resilientes, escalables y alineadas con los objetivos estratégicos.
Recuerde que el marco es una herramienta, no un manual de reglas. Debe adaptarse para satisfacer las necesidades específicas de la organización. La flexibilidad dentro de la estructura permite la innovación manteniendo la estabilidad.
A medida que la tecnología evoluciona, también debe evolucionar la arquitectura. Las revisiones periódicas y la gestión de cambios aseguran que el sistema siga siendo adecuado para su propósito. Con una base sólida establecida durante la Fase Preliminar y un plan claro de migración, el camino hacia adelante se vuelve manejable.
El camino desde la visión hasta la implementación es largo, pero con el ADM como guía, el destino es claro. Enfóquese en el valor que aporta a los negocios, y los detalles técnicos seguirán de forma natural.












